How to fill out single family residential interior:
01
Start by assessing the space: Take a thorough look at the interior of the single family residential property. Consider the layout, existing architectural elements, and functionality of the space. Identify any areas that need improvement or updates.
02
Plan the design: Before diving into filling out the interior, it is important to have a clear vision of how you want the space to look and function. Consider factors such as style, color palette, furniture placement, lighting, and overall ambiance. Create a mood board or gather inspiration to guide your design decisions.
03
Set a budget: Determine how much you are willing to invest in renovating or decorating the interior. This will help you make informed decisions when selecting materials, furniture, and decor. Research and compare prices to make the most of your budget.
04
Choose a color scheme: Select a cohesive color palette that sets the tone for the interior. Consider the mood you want to create in each room. Neutrals are versatile and timeless, while bold colors can add personality and flair. Make sure the selected colors complement each other and flow seamlessly throughout the space.
05
Select furniture and accessories: Consider the purpose of each room and choose furniture that suits the lifestyle and needs of the inhabitants. Optimize the use of space by selecting appropriately sized pieces. Mix and match styles and textures to create visual interest. Don't forget to consider comfort and functionality when selecting furniture.
06
Consider lighting options: Good lighting can enhance the overall atmosphere and functionality of a space. Combine overhead lighting, natural light, and task lighting to create both ambient and practical illumination. Choose fixtures and bulbs that complement the style and purpose of each room.
07
Pay attention to details: It's often the small details that make a significant difference in the overall design. Consider window treatments, wall art, rugs, and decorative accessories that reflect your personal style and add character to the space. Don't forget to incorporate organizational systems to maintain a clutter-free environment.
08
Seek professional help if needed: If you feel overwhelmed or unsure about how to fill out the single family residential interior, consider consulting with a professional interior designer. They can provide guidance, expertise, and a fresh perspective to help you achieve your desired result.
